Where Is The Relief Money for Haiti?

The story of the recovery that hasn’t happened in Haiti is at last partially a tale of the money the developed world said it would give, but didn’t. In the immediate aftermath of last year’s earthquake there was a worldwide outpouring of support.

Haiti
January 12, 2010:
1.5 million homeless
Killed more than 230000

January 12, 2011:
1 million still homeless
2100 died of cholera
And over 93000 infected

Where is the Relief Money?

$12 billion total pledged through organizations, the UN, private donors and individual countries.

$5.3 billion pledged 2010-2011 at UN conference = $1.3 billion disbursed.

U.S. disbursed $120 million of $1.2 billion pledged.
European community disbursed $97.2 million of $294 million pledged.
Canada disbursed $55.3 million of $375 million pledged.

$1.4 billion from private American donors = 38% spent.

$479 million raised by the American Red Cross = $200 million spent.
